How do you pronounce “hence”?

“hence” is pronounced HENS — IPA /ˈhɛns/. In Ingglish phonetic spelling, where every spelling always makes the same sound, it is written “hens”.

How many syllables are in “hence”?

“hence” has 1 syllable: HENS (the capitalized syllable is stressed).
